9.3 Writing a parameter

When transferring parameter orders, it must be taken into account that the slave does not immediately
respond to orders in the parameter channel of the master telegram, but a positive response can be
delayed by one or more communication cycles. The master must therefore repeat the required order
until the corresponding slave response is received. PPO type 1 or PPO type 2 must be selected as the
PPO type.

WARNING

The maximum number or write cycles on the EEPROM of the frequency inverters is limited
to 100,000 cycles. Continuous writing to the EEPROM therefore results in the destruction
of the EEPROM.

Writing to the RAM of the frequency inverter should therefore be used for writing
parameter data. The setting for this is made in parameter P560 of the frequency inverter.
